Output 831ba95eedd93517ecc7e12dc005bd6c5ff0becb21205be8c470b2ffc2f68691: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84f54fd4a39294e1e0fe521169334199a2c654e OP_EQUAL
address
3MQkv4aDjr6AQKTVKKYQH6GjcG4CtgR62B
transaction
831ba95eedd93517ecc7e12dc005bd6c5ff0becb21205be8c470b2ffc2f68691
spent
true